What steel is used for wire rope?

Steel wires for wire ropes are normally made of non-alloy carbon steel with a carbon content of 0.4 to 0.95%. The very high strength of the rope wires enables wire ropes to support large tensile forces and to run over sheaves with relatively small diameters.

What is the difference between steel cable and wire rope?

The terms are often used interchangeably, but are they different? Each is considered a machine. Wire ropes are usually ⅜” in diameter or larger, while cables or cords are smaller. Though this little distinction exists in aircraft and marine cables, wire ropes and cables are synonymous in most other ways.

What is the grade of wire rope?

Grade of Rope The strength of wire rope is broken down into different grades, including: Improved Plow Steel (IPS) Extra Improved Plow Steel (EIPS) is 15% stronger than IPS. Extra Extra Improved Plow Steel (EEIPS) is 10% stronger than EIPS.

What grade of steel is most commonly used in wire rope slings?

GRADE & CONSTRUCTION of wire rope for slings is generally accepted to be bright Improved Plow Steel or Extra Improved Plow Steel grade 6×19 or 6×37 classifica- tion regular lay.

What’s the difference between wire rope and cable?

The term cable is often used interchangeably with wire rope. However, in general, wire rope refers to diameters larger than 3/8 inch. Sizes smaller than this are designated as cable or cords. Two or more wires concentrically laid around a center wire is called a strand.

Which type of wire rope is the most flexible?

A rope that has more strands exhibits greater flexibility than one with fewer strands. Crush resistance: Although wire rope with a fiber core offers the most flexibility, it also demonstrates less resistance to crushing. If crushing is not a concern but flexibility is, fiber core wire rope is ideal.
